I happened to come accross the name Toad the Wet Sprocket the other day and it reminded me of the Marsh House Music Festival.

As some may recall Toad were the traditional headliners that were eventually removed from the top of the bill by the new wave/goth invasion.

The first festival that comes to mind featured the Jets and the Nervous Surgeons. Both bands evolved into the Teevees and Click Click, although I can not recall the details of the metamorphis.

Although my memory has faded I recall UK Decay and possibly Pneumania appearing at later versions and possibly the Acme Attractions and in true festival style at least one of these occassions was just an almighty mud bath.

I can not remember if UK Decay ever topped this festival as it faded out around 1980-81 but if it was them that got the aweful Toad the Wet Sprocket off the bill - I would like to record an almighty thank you.

On the list for this was Attila the Stockbroker, Nick the Poet, Newtown Neurotics and Karma Sutra. As I recall the weather was none too kind, but the merrydown was flowing. I was living just across the road at the time, which was fortunate because at one point my lovely mates decided it would be a hoot to try chucking each other in the river.... and guess who ended up taking an early bath?
Good gig, though.
